Convert Kibibit to Exabit

Unit definitions

Kibibit

${2}^{10}$ bits equal one kibibit.

Exabit

${10}^{18}$ bits equal one exabit.

How to convert Kibibit to Exabit

$$\text{Data and Storage}_{\text{Eb}} = \frac{\text{Data and Storage}_{\text{Kib}}}{976562500000000}$$
